Board certification through an ABMS or AOA member board signals voluntary post-licensure examination plus Maintenance of Certification cycles. CMS does not publish a per-provider board-certification field; the figure shown is the specialty-level estimated rate from ABMS / AOA reference data.
The Merit-based Incentive Payment System (MIPS) scores providers 0–100 across four performance categories: Quality, Cost, Promoting Interoperability, and Improvement Activities, weighted under 42 CFR §414.1380. Reporting is voluntary for many small practices, so absence of a MIPS score is not a quality signal.

SARA BOMAR, M.D. appears in the CMS NPPES registry as a General Practice Physician provider holding M.D. credentials at 100 COVEY DR STE 204, FRANKLIN, TN, 37067, with a listed phone of (615) 656-0589. NPI 1356722755 was issued on 06/11/2015. Because NPPES data is self-reported by the provider and refreshed monthly, the address, phone, and specialty reflect what BOMAR most recently submitted to CMS rather than a vetted directory listing, which is why patients should always confirm the practice is still at this location before scheduling.
Medicare Part D records for calendar year 2023 show 365 prescription claims written by this provider, covering 22 Medicare beneficiaries and totaling roughly $20K in drug spend. These figures capture only Medicare Part D — commercial insurance, Medicaid, and cash-pay prescriptions are not included, and any drug-beneficiary cell under 11 is suppressed by CMS for patient privacy.
General Practice Physician is a mid-sized specialty nationwide, with 16,677 enrolled providers across 56 states and an average of 2,872 Part D claims per prescriber, so the context for interpreting these metrics differs meaningfully from a primary-care baseline.
